Output 584dd2a7ea76d98174016eba5871d8c93a6b3333d182a06d8a2f8bd9bbce439f:1

value
136117
script pubkey
OP_0 OP_PUSHBYTES_20 e534730c53a1ff1d5c6428c2bab2cd14c5fa0978
address
bc1qu568xrzn58l36hry9rpt4vkdznzl5ztcc9g2q4
transaction
584dd2a7ea76d98174016eba5871d8c93a6b3333d182a06d8a2f8bd9bbce439f
confirmations
3095
spent
true